Lake Geneva Farmland Showdown Has Neighbors Split Over YMCA And First Responder Hub
A stretch of farmland along Highway 120 is under contract to the Geneva Lakes YMCA while the city eyes the other half for police and fire; neighbors are divided and the council set a six‑month review.
Loop Office Sharks Snag Cut-Rate Control Of 200 W. Monroe
Franklin Partners and Bixby Bridge Capital bought the loan on the 23‑story tower at 200 W. Monroe in the Loop, marking another discounted Chicago‑area office deal. The purchase spotlights continued distress and opportunistic buying in the downtown market.
Wilmette Stunner: Optima Locks In $60 Million For Downtown Luxe Rentals
Optima converted construction debt into a $60M Freddie Mac refinance for its 100‑unit Optima Verdana in Wilmette, clearing the way for an adjacent 128‑unit phase. The move reflects strong suburban demand for stabilized luxury rentals.
Feds Greenlight Realtors to Talk Crime and Schools Again
HUD told real‑estate professionals on April 24 that they may lawfully discuss neighborhood crime rates and school quality with buyers, if the information is given consistently. The agency's FHEO letter says such conversations are not automatic violations of the Fair Housing Act.
